Implement Strategies to Attract High-Quality Leads
To generate better leads from Facebook Lead Form Ads, focus on qualifying questions within your forms. Ask about specific service needs, urgency, or budget to filter out less serious inquiries upfront. Ensure your ad copy and visuals are highly targeted to your ideal customer, clearly setting expectations about your services. Consider adding a review screen to your lead form, allowing users to confirm their information before submission, which helps reduce accidental submissions. Finally, integrate your lead forms directly with your CRM for immediate follow-up. Prompt contact significantly increases the chance of converting a lead into a booked job, directly impacting your booking rates and overall lead quality.
Track Key Metrics Beyond Just Lead Count
Measuring the true quality of Facebook Lead Form Ads requires looking beyond simple submission numbers. Focus on metrics like the lead-to-appointment booking rate, the appointment-to-job completion rate, and the actual revenue generated per lead. Monitor the completion rate of your lead forms; a low rate might indicate a form that is too long or confusing. Also, assess the responsiveness of leads once contacted—are they answering calls or emails? Tracking these deeper metrics provides a clearer picture of lead effectiveness. This approach ensures your marketing efforts are generating actual business, not just a list of contacts that never convert.

Integrate Facebook Leads Directly with Your CRM
For a complete understanding of lead quality and campaign performance, integrate your Facebook Lead Form Ads directly with your Customer Relationship Management (CRM) system. Platforms such as ServiceTitan, Jobber, or GoHighLevel can automatically pull lead data into your sales pipeline. This integration allows your team to track each lead's journey from initial inquiry through to a closed job. By tagging leads with their source, like 'Facebook Lead Form Ad,' you can analyze which ad campaigns are generating the most profitable customers. This closed-loop reporting is crucial for accurately calculating your cost per booked job and optimizing your Facebook ad spend for maximum return on investment.

Understand How Facebook Lead Form Ads Work
Facebook Lead Form Ads are designed for efficient mobile lead generation. When a user clicks your ad, a form appears directly within Facebook or Instagram, often pre-filled with their contact details like name, email, and phone number. This simplifies the submission process, making it quick and easy for potential customers. For home service contractors, this means collecting essential customer information without requiring them to leave their social media feed. These forms are customizable, allowing you to ask specific questions relevant to your services. While designed for seamless lead capture, this ease of submission can sometimes result in lower-quality inquiries if not managed with clear qualification in mind.
